Leverage

Fullerton offers a maximum leverage of 1:500 to its clients. Leverage is a financial tool that allows traders to amplify their trading positions by borrowing funds from the broker. With a leverage ratio of 1:500, clients can control a position size up to 500 times larger than their actual account balance.

This high leverage ratio can potentially increase both profits and losses, as even small market movements can have a significant impact on the trading account. It is important to note that trading with high leverage involves a higher level of risk, and traders should exercise caution and employ risk management strategies to protect their capital.

Spreads &Commissions

Fullerton Markets offers three types of spreads to its clients:

  1. Variable Spreads: These spreads are derived from Tier-One Liquidity Providers in Equinix LD4, a specialized data center for foreign exchange in London. When trading on the Fullerton Markets MT4 & MT5 platforms, clients are charged a brokerage fee collected from the spreads. There are no additional commissions for trade execution.

  2. Raw Spreads: With raw spreads, clients can enjoy spreads as low as 0 pips, derived directly from multiple Liquidity Providers including banks and hedge funds in Equinix LD4. However, a flat fee of USD 8 per lot is charged as a commission for Forex instruments. This allows traders to access the market directly, benefiting from competitive pricing.

  3. PRO Spreads: Traders using the Fullerton Markets MT4 & MT5 platforms can enjoy lower spreads, with no commissions, swaps, or additional fees when trading Forex and Metals. These spreads are derived from Tier-One Liquidity Providers in Equinix LD4, offering a cost-effective trading experience without incurring extra charges.

It's important for clients to review the Terms & Conditions provided by Fullerton Markets to understand the specific details and requirements associated with each type of spread and commission structure.

Deposit & Withdrawal

Deposit: Fullerton Markets offers a variety of convenient deposit methods to suit the needs of traders worldwide. Traders can choose to fund their accounts using credit cards, digital wallets, bank wire transfers, or cryptocurrencies. Credit card deposits are available in USD, EUR, and SGD currencies, with no minimum deposit amount required. Sticpay and digital wallet deposits are also available in USD, EUR, and SGD, with no minimum deposit requirement. For bank wire transfers, traders can deposit in USD, EUR, SGD, or NZD currencies, with a minimum deposit of USD 200 or equivalent value in other currencies.

Withdrawal: Fullerton Markets provides hassle-free withdrawal options for traders to access their funds. The minimum withdrawal amounts vary depending on the chosen method. For credit card, digital wallet, and cryptocurrency withdrawals, there is no minimum withdrawal amount. However, for Bitcoin withdrawals, a minimum withdrawal of USD 100 is required. Bank wire transfers have a minimum withdrawal amount of USD 200 or equivalent in other currencies. Additionally, Fullerton Markets covers all withdrawal fees, ensuring that traders can access their funds without any additional charges.

It's important to note that specific requirements and limits may apply for local transfers in different countries, such as Malaysia, Vietnam, Thailand, Indonesia, Philippines, China, Myanmar, Cambodia, Laos, and India. Traders should review the specific minimum and maximum withdrawal amounts for each country to ensure compliance with the respective regulations.

Is Axiory legit or a scam?

Axiory is authorized and regulated by the Financial Services Commission (IFSC) in Belize. This regulatory body is responsible for ensuring that financial institutions operate in a transparent and fair manner, which can provide traders with some reassurance about the legitimacy of the broker. Axiory's adherence to regulations also means that the company must follow certain guidelines, such as maintaining sufficient capital reserves, which can help to protect traders in the event of any financial instability.

However, it is important to note that the IFSC is not a highly-respected regulatory body in the financial industry, which may lead some traders to question the level of oversight and protection provided. Additionally, the regulatory requirements of the IFSC may not be as stringent as those of other regulatory bodies, which could result in less protection for traders.

Account Types

Axiory offers a diverse range of trading accounts to cater to the needs of traders with varying experience levels and trading styles. The broker offers five types of trading accounts, including NANO, STANDARD, MAX, TERA, and ALPHA.

The NANO account is an account type with a small deposit amount of $10. This account type features average spreads starting at 0.3 pips, with leverage up to 1:400 and this account holder can get access to MT4 and cTrader trading platforms.

The STANDARD account is suitable for traders who have some trading experience and are willing to deposit a minimum of $10. This account type features floating spreads starting from 1.3 pips, and has the same lever ratio as the NANO account, and traders who open this account can use trading platforms too: MT4 and cTrader.

The MAX account is designed for experienced traders who are willing to deposit a minimum of $10. This account type features a huge spread of 20 pips on average, with leverage up to 1:777, trading through MT4 and cTrader.

The TERA account is another account with a low deposit requirement of $10. This account type features an average spread starting at 3 pips, and a maximum leverage of 1:400. Please note traders who open this account only can get access to one trading platform, that is the MT5 trading platform.

The ALPHA account is a premium account type that is available by invitation only. As such, the minimum deposit requirement is unknown. This account type offers institutional-grade spreads and a maximum leverage of 1:1. With this broker, only MT5 trading platform can be reached.

Islamic Accounts

Axiory offers Islamic accounts, also known as swap-free accounts, which are designed for traders who follow the Islamic faith and can not receive or pay interest due to religious reasons. These accounts comply with Shariah law and do not charge or pay any overnight interest (swap) fees on positions held open for more than 24 hours.

Islamic accounts at Axiory offer the same features as standard trading accounts, including access to all trading instruments and platforms, customer support, and educational resources. The only difference is that Islamic accounts operate on a commission-based structure, and there are no overnight swap fees charged or credited to the account.

To open an Islamic account with Axiory, traders need to submit a request to the customer support team, and the account will be verified and set up within 24 hours. It is important to note that Axiory reserves the right to revoke the swap-free status if there is evidence of abuse or misuse of the account.

Spreads & Commissions (Trading Fees)

Axiory's spreads can be higher compared to some other forex brokers. For the NANO account, the average spreads start at 0.3 pips. The STANDARD account has floating spreads starting from 1.2 pips, which is a bit more competitive. The MAX account has floating spreads starting from 1.3 pips, and on average, the spreads for this account are around 20 pips. The TERA account has an average spread starting at 3 pips, while the spreads for the ALPHA account are not disclosed on the Axiory website.

In terms of commissions, Axiory charges a commission of $ 6 per lot for the NANO accounts. The Standard and MAX accounts do not charge a commission, but it has higher spreads. The TERA and ALPHA accounts have lower spreads, but their commission fees are charged 6 usd per lot and 1.5 usd per lot, respectively.

Non-Trading Fees

In addition to trading fees, Axiory also charges non-trading fees that traders should be aware of. Axiory does not charge any deposit or withdrawal fees, which is a big advantage for traders. However, there are some other non-trading fees that traders should consider, including inactivity fees. If there is no trading activity on the account for 6 months, a fee of $30 per month will be charged. Also, Axiory charges a fee for wire transfers, which can vary depending on the currency and the bank used. Traders should check with their bank for any additional fees that may be charged on their end.

Deposit & Withdrawal

Deposit

The minimum deposit is 10 USD. If clients are using a Bank Wire Transfer from any country except Nigeria, the minimum deposit is 100 USD. The minimum deposit using Bank Wire Transfer from Nigeria is 10 USD. Visa and bank transfer are the most traditional options, while e-wallets such as Skrill and Neteller are also available. Stickpay is a unique payment method that allows for instant deposits and withdrawals, while PayReedem and ThunderXPay are also available. Additionally, Axiory does not charge any deposit fees.

payment-methods
payment-methods

Withdrawal

The minimum withdrawal amount at Axiory is 10 USD with the exception of Wire/Bank Transfer where the minimum withdrawal amount is 100 USD.

Axiory supports the same deposit and withdrawal payment methods, which include Visa, Bank Transfer, Stickpay, Neteller, Skrill, PayReedem, and ThunderXPay. The processing time for withdrawals can vary depending on the payment method used, with e-wallets typically being the fastest and bank transfers taking the longest. Axiory does not charge any withdrawal fees, but it is possible that the payment provider may charge a fee for their services.
